1.Fiddler Everywhere下载安装
1.1下载地址并安装
链接: pan.baidu.com/s/172_Ghk3J… 密码: lo4h
1.2 打开安装后的Fiddler Everywhere
如果无法打开,请移步至
设置
的安全性与隐私设置
允许打开
1.3 注册
输入信息注册一个账号
前往邮箱确认
如果不在邮箱进行确认,是无法登录注册的账号的
返回Fiddler Everywhere登录
2.配置Fiddler Everywhere
2.1配置支持Https
默认情况下是不支持https的抓包的,需要在这里设置后才能支持
2.2设置端口号和代理对象
- 8866是端口号,在设置代理对象时需要设置成与这个一致,它的取值范围是0~65535;
- 设置
Act as system proxy on startup
时,可以抓取电脑的网络请求;- 设置
Allow remote computers to connect
时,可以抓取设置代理对象(比如手机)的网络请求.
2.3设置代理配置
Use system proxy
使用系统代理;Manul proxy configuration
设置手动代理;No proxy
不使用代理。
3.使用Fiddler Everywhere抓包电脑自身网络请求的包
3.1在safari浏览器
中打开百度
3.2在Fiddler Everywhere 中显示的抓包内容
- 左边部分:Result请求状态值,200显示请求成功;Protocol请求代理,为http;URL请求链连。
- 右边部分:Request请求信息,Response响应信息.
4.配置手机为代理对象
4.1手机与电脑接入同一局域网
使用手机与电脑连入同一个WiFi
- 设置
手动
代理;- 服务器为电脑的ip地址;
- 端口为Fiddler Everywhere中设置的端口号。
4.2 修改Fiddler Everywhere设置
4.3 查看手机网络请求抓包数据
打开手机淘宝的抓包数据结果如下
总结
关于Fiddler Everywhere
的使用自己去玩吧!